SoapMessage::ContentType Property

 

Gets or sets the HTTP Content-Type of the SOAP request or SOAP response.

Namespace:   System.Web.Services.Protocols
Assembly:  System.Web.Services (in System.Web.Services.dll)

public:
property String^ ContentType {
	String^ get();
	void set(String^ value);
}

Property Value

Type: System::String^

The HTTP Content-Type of the SOAP request or SOAP response. The default is "text/xml".

Exception Condition
InvalidOperationException

ContentType is accessed AfterSerialize or AfterDeserialize stages.

The ContentType property can only be accessed in the BeforeSerialize and BeforeDeserialize stages; otherwise, an InvalidOperationException is thrown.

Use the ContentEncoding property, instead of the ContentType property to provide supplementary information about the encoding of a SOAP message.

myStreamWriter->WriteLine( "The contents of HTTP Content-type header is:" );
myStreamWriter->WriteLine( "\t{0}", message->ContentType );

.NET Framework
Available since 1.1
Return to top
Show: